Understanding the Google Cybersecurity Certificate

The Google Cybersecurity Professional Certificate is an eight-course online credential hosted on Coursera, designed to deliver approximately 170 hours of instruction over a typical six-month timeline at about seven hours per week. Pricing ranges from $39 to $49 per month, making the total cost roughly $234 if you progress steadily. The curriculum covers fundamental cybersecurity concepts such as threat identification, risk management, network defense, and incident response. Students also gain practical experience with Linux, SQL, and Python—three in-demand technologies in modern security operations. This program advertises itself as “beginner-friendly,” intending to democratize access to cybersecurity education without requiring prior qualifications or degree programs.

“Cybersecurity isn’t a beginner’s endeavor, and companies are not going to give you critical roles if you’re a total beginner,” warns many hiring managers.

Despite this caution, the certificate seeks to bridge the gap by scaffolding core competencies in an accessible format. It prepares learners for entry-level roles like Security Operations Center (SOC) Analyst and serves as a stepping stone toward industry certifications such as CompTIA Security+ and CISSP foundations.

What Makes the Certificate Stand Out?

Several features distinguish the Google certificate from other online credentials. First, the production quality is exceptional. As expected from Google, the video lectures, interactive quizzes, and platform interface are clean, engaging, and intuitive. This high polish reduces cognitive friction and helps learners focus on mastering concepts rather than wrestling with clunky software.

Second, the certificate emphasizes foundational learning by breaking down complex attack frameworks—like the MITRE ATT&CK matrix—into digestible modules. Many students who once struggled with security frameworks report clarity and confidence after completing these sections.

Third, the curriculum’s explicit focus on Linux and SQL ensures that learners acquire skills directly applicable to roles in network defense and data analysis. Unlike generic programming courses, these modules contextualize commands and queries within security workflows, giving students realistic practice scenarios rather than abstract code examples.

Finally, the Google brand name itself carries weight with hiring managers. Even for candidates with limited professional experience, listing a Google credential on a resume can trigger a positive signal about quality assurance and rigor, potentially opening interviews that might otherwise remain out of reach.

Innovative AI Integration

In 2025, Google updated the certificate to include hands-on AI integration, reflecting the growing role of machine learning in security operations. Students practice using AI-driven tools for vulnerability scanning, anomaly detection, and intelligent log parsing. They build simple Python scripts that leverage AI libraries to flag unusual network traffic patterns or identify code vulnerabilities.

This AI focus is more than theoretical; it aligns with real-world job requirements in many security operations centers. As organizations increasingly adopt AI assistants to automate rote tasks, candidates who can demonstrate both traditional security knowledge and AI tool proficiency gain a competitive edge. This blend of skills—cybersecurity fundamentals augmented by AI automation—positions certificate holders ahead of peers still relying exclusively on manual processes.

Insights from Hiring Managers and Experienced Students

Real-world feedback is essential for evaluating any certificate’s worth. According to Google’s reporting, 75% of graduates experience a career improvement—whether through promotions, salary increases, or new job opportunities. Moreover, data shows over 28,000 open cybersecurity roles in the United States alone, with a median entry-level salary of around $115,000. These numbers suggest robust demand for candidates who hold recognized credentials.

Hiring managers emphasize three key factors when considering certificate holders: demonstrated technical ability, relevant project portfolios, and the credibility of the issuing organization. Google’s certificate addresses all three by including portfolio-building activities—such as creating network security plans and simulated incident response reports—and leveraging Google’s own reputation.

That said, some graduates note that confidence in job interviews often comes from hands-on lab experience beyond the course. A few recommend supplementing the certificate with home lab practice or preparatory study for certifications like CompTIA Security+ to solidify their skill set before applying for roles.

Who Should Consider This Certificate?

The Google Cybersecurity Certificate caters to a diverse audience:

• Complete beginners seeking structured, low-cost entry into cybersecurity.
• IT professionals aiming to pivot into security-focused positions by filling knowledge gaps in risk management and network protection.
• Career changers with non-technical backgrounds—such as educators or customer service specialists—who need an organized curriculum to build technical fluency quickly.
• Seasoned practitioners who value Google’s perspectives on best practices and want to update their skills, particularly in AI-assisted security tasks.

For many learners, the certificate represents an affordable alternative to $10,000+ boot camps or four-year degrees that often exceed $100,000 in total cost. Its modular structure and flexible pacing further appeal to working professionals balancing study with existing commitments.

Next Steps and Additional Resources

Earning the certificate is only one milestone on a long cybersecurity career path. To maximize your opportunities:

  1. Build a home lab: Set up virtual machines and experiment with penetration testing tools like Kali Linux.
  2. Pursue complementary certifications: CompTIA Security+ for foundational validation, and then advanced credentials like CEH or CISSP.
  3. Join professional communities: Participate in security meetups, online forums, and LinkedIn groups to network with peers and recruiters.
  4. Tailor your resume: Highlight certificate projects and use Google’s name as a credibility booster. Emphasize quantifiable outcomes, such as “Developed a Python script to automate log analysis, reducing incident triage time by 30%.”

Leveraging these next steps turns a certificate into a springboard for meaningful job interviews and impactful roles.
